🎨 AI Image Generation Guide

The most challenging aspect of crafting an artistic portrait through torn paper is achieving the right balance between the background and the subject. This technique can easily overwhelm the portrait if not executed skillfully, making it critical to control the visual flow while ensuring the subject remains the focal point. When I work with an ai image generator, I often focus on how the torn edges can add an interesting texture that complements the portrait rather than distracts from it.

Camera Settings

Using a wide aperture (around f/2.8 to f/4) helps create a shallow depth of field, allowing the subject to pop against the torn paper background. A low ISO (100-200) is ideal to minimize noise, especially if you’re working in a controlled setting. Ensure your shutter speed is fast enough to avoid motion blur—at least 1/125s for portraits.

Lighting Setup

Studio lighting is crucial here. Soft, diffused lighting can enhance skin tones and textures. Set up a key light at a 45-degree angle to the subject, using a softbox to reduce harsh shadows. A reflector can help bounce light back onto the subject, ensuring even illumination without losing the dramatic effect of the torn paper.

Common Mistakes

    1. Overexposing the background can lead to loss of detail in the torn edges.
    2. Using too much contrast between the subject and the background can make the image feel disjointed.
    3. Neglecting to align the subject properly with the torn edges can create an awkward visual flow.

Creative Tips

Experiment with different colors and patterns for the torn paper to enhance mood and theme. When using an image creation tool, try various textures that can complement the subject’s clothing. Additionally, consider incorporating layers of torn paper to create depth, drawing the viewer's eye into the portrait. This layered approach can also add a unique storytelling element to your work.
